💡 What You Need to Know

  • Definition: Chest trauma refers to any injury to the chest wall, lungs, heart, great vessels, esophagus, or diaphragm.
  • Causes: Can be blunt (e.g., motor vehicle accidents, falls, direct impact) or penetrating (e.g., stab wounds, gunshot wounds).
  • Severity: Ranges from minor contusions to life-threatening conditions like tension pneumothorax, massive hemothorax, cardiac tamponade, or aortic rupture.
  • Urgency: Requires immediate medical evaluation due to the potential for rapid deterioration and high mortality if not promptly managed.

🤒 Associated Symptoms

  • Chest Pain: Often severe, localized, and may worsen with breathing or movement (pleuritic pain).
  • Dyspnea: Shortness of breath, difficulty breathing, or rapid, shallow breathing (tachypnea).
  • Bruising/Deformity: Visible contusions, abrasions, or paradoxical chest wall movement (flail chest).
  • Crepitus: A crackling sensation under the skin due to subcutaneous emphysema (air trapped in tissues).
  • Hemoptysis: Coughing up blood, indicating lung injury.
  • Hypotension/Tachycardia: Signs of shock, suggesting significant blood loss or cardiac compromise.
  • Tracheal Deviation: Shift of the trachea away from the injured side, a critical sign of tension pneumothorax.
  • Distended Neck Veins: May indicate increased intrathoracic pressure or cardiac tamponade.
  • Diminished Breath Sounds: On the affected side, suggesting pneumothorax or hemothorax.

🛡 Crucial Precautions

  • Scene Safety: Ensure the environment is safe for both the patient and first responders before approaching.
  • Do Not Remove Impaled Objects: Stabilize any penetrating objects in place to prevent further damage or hemorrhage.
  • Airway Management: Prioritize securing a patent airway, especially if the patient has facial or neck trauma.
  • Spinal Immobilization: Assume concomitant spinal injury until ruled out, especially in high-impact blunt trauma.
  • Monitor for Tension Pneumothorax: Watch for sudden worsening of respiratory distress, hypotension, and tracheal deviation.
  • Open Pneumothorax Management: Apply a three-sided occlusive dressing to any sucking chest wound to prevent tension pneumothorax.
  • Rapid Transport: Expedite transfer to a trauma center for definitive care.

🍽 Dietary Directions & Restrictions

  • NPO Status: Maintain nothing by mouth (NPO) immediately upon presentation due to the high likelihood of requiring emergency surgery or intubation.
  • Intravenous Fluids: Administer IV fluids as prescribed to maintain hydration and support hemodynamic stability, especially if there is significant blood loss.
  • Post-Stabilization Diet: Once stable and surgical intervention is ruled out or completed, gradually reintroduce clear liquids, then a soft diet, progressing as tolerated and based on the patient's overall condition and bowel function.
  • Nutritional Support: For prolonged recovery or severe injuries, consider enteral or parenteral nutrition to support healing and prevent malnutrition.

⚠️ Attendant Guidelines

  • Call Emergency Services: Immediately dial emergency medical services (e.g., 911) and provide clear details of the incident and patient's condition.
  • Maintain Airway: If the patient is unconscious, position them to maintain an open airway, if safe to do so without moving the spine.
  • Control External Bleeding: Apply direct, firm pressure to any visible external bleeding points on the chest with a clean cloth.
  • Monitor Vital Signs: Continuously observe the patient for changes in breathing, level of consciousness, and skin color until professional help arrives.
  • Provide Reassurance: Keep the patient calm and warm, offering comfort and support while awaiting medical personnel.

🩺 Physician's Perspective

  • Primary Survey (ABCDE): Follow ATLS guidelines for rapid assessment and management of life-threatening injuries.
  • Imaging: Utilize chest X-ray, focused assessment with sonography for trauma (FAST) exam, and CT scan of the chest to identify specific injuries.
  • Interventions: Be prepared for emergent procedures such as chest tube insertion for pneumothorax/hemothorax, pericardiocentesis for cardiac tamponade, or thoracotomy for massive hemorrhage.
  • Pain Management: Aggressively manage pain to improve respiratory mechanics and prevent complications like atelectasis and pneumonia.
  • Prophylaxis: Administer tetanus prophylaxis and consider antibiotics for penetrating injuries or open fractures.

🎓 Academic & Nursing Corner

  • Comprehensive Assessment: Perform frequent respiratory assessments, including rate, depth, effort, symmetry, and auscultation of breath sounds.
  • Chest Tube Management: Understand the principles of chest tube insertion, maintenance, and troubleshooting, including monitoring drainage and air leaks.
  • Pain Assessment: Utilize appropriate pain scales and administer analgesia effectively to facilitate deep breathing and coughing.
  • Monitoring for Complications: Vigilantly watch for signs of acute respiratory distress syndrome (ARDS), pneumonia, sepsis, and cardiac arrhythmias.
  • Patient Education: Educate patients on incentive spirometry, deep breathing exercises, and early ambulation to prevent pulmonary complications.

🔬 Clinical Reference Index

  • Pneumothorax: Air in the pleural space.
  • Hemothorax: Blood in the pleural space.
  • Flail Chest: Paradoxical movement of a segment of the chest wall due to multiple rib fractures.
  • Cardiac Tamponade: Compression of the heart due to fluid accumulation in the pericardial sac.
  • Pulmonary Contusion: Bruising of the lung tissue.
  • Aortic Disruption: Tear in the aorta, often life-threatening.
  • Thoracostomy: Surgical creation of an opening into the chest cavity, typically for chest tube insertion.
  • Pericardiocentesis: Procedure to remove fluid from the pericardial sac.
  • ATLS: Advanced Trauma Life Support protocol.
